Denial of MEIS benefit - omitted to check the Box stating 'Yes' - There is no justification in denying the claim, based on such an inadvertent omission. In the matter of condoning such an omission, there cannot be a discrimination between exporters who made the claim within six months and those who have raised the claim after six months of introduction of the Scheme.
